It’s been teased for a while now, but Freebird Games has finally announced the release date for the third installment in the To the Moon series. Titled Impostor Factory, the game received an official trailer last year, and it’ll be released on PC via Steam on Sept. 30.

Just like To the Moon and Finding Paradise before it, Impostor Factory can be played and enjoyed as a standalone experience. Here’s a brief synopsis:

“One day, Quincy was invited to a fancy parteh at a suspiciously secluded mansion. So he accepted and went; because even though the mansion was suspicious and secluded, it was also fancy and had a parteh.
In fact, it turned out to be so fancy that there was a time machine in its bathroom. Quincycould wash his hands and time-travel while he was at it. Talk about a time-saver!
But of course, then people start dying, because that’s what they do. And somewhere along the way, things get a little Lovecraftian and tentacles are involved.
Anyway, that’s around 1/3 of what the game is really about.”
